Santa Pola is a working fishing port on the Costa Blanca, known for its active fleet and its proximity to the Salinas de Santa Pola nature park. The completely flat, sea-level course is considered one of Spain's four best half marathons, drawing around 8,000-10,000 runners across the 10K and half marathon distances. AIMS-certified, it is regarded as one of the fastest courses in the country thanks to its flat terrain.
